Title: Request for Application (RFA) - To Expand the Health Insurance Coverage to the Informal Sector and Achieve Progress Towards Universal Health Coverage (UHC) in Ebonyi, Bauchi, Sokoto and Federal Capital Territory (FCT)under the "USAID integrated Health Program"

Overview
USAID’s Integrated Health Program (IHP) invites qualified local entities, Nigerian Non-governmental Organizations (For-Profit and Not-for-Profit), non-governmental professional associations, training institutions and other qualified organizations to submit concept notes and full applications(if shortlisted) with respect to technical, managerial, and other aspects of the program described below.

IHP is seeking interested eligible organizations that have interest to expand the health insurance coverage to the informal sector and achieve progress towards Universal Health Coverage (UHC) and to specifically address the low public awareness and enrollment of the people in the informal sector, IHP is seeking the services of a Grant Under Contract (GUC) to support the State Contributory Schemes- SCHS in their efforts to expand the informal sector enrollment including collaboration with the Third-Party Administrators (TPAs) such as Health Maintenance Organizations (HMOs) in developing and implementing strategies that will accelerate the participation of the informal sector groups in the SCHS and to ensure sustainability after the end of the GUC period.

Through the GUC, the prospective awardee will implement innovative mechanisms to expand the informal sector enrollment, for instance, through marketing, behavior change communication, and the physical enrollment of informal sector individuals and their families in support of the state health insurance agency to attain state coverage targets. The GUC will also help strengthen the capacity of the agencies in clients’ registration, premium collection including Produce conversion, Seasonal collection, Product Layered contribution, and Installment Payment. The GUC will support the agencies in identifying and establishing collaborations with the relevant Ministries, Departments and Agencies (MOAS) of the state Governments and beneficiary groups in the informal sector that are critical to the successful Implementation of the financing mechanisms. The GUC will build the capacity of a dedicated marketing team of the SCHS and the TPAs such that they can effectively continue with the implementation of the informal sector roll-out and enrollment strategies after the conclusion of the IHP-supported technical assistance.

Goals and Objectives
To expand the health insurance coverage to the informal sector and achieve progress towards Universal Health Coverage (UHC) in Ebonyi, Bauchi, Sokoto and Federal Capital Territory (FCT).

Objectives
Using locally proven approaches and interventions through a Fixed Amount Award (Grants Under Contract funding mechanism), the awardee will:
  • Increase the number of informal sectors enrolees in the State Contributory Health Schemes,
  • Implement a workable informal sector enrollment plan.
  • Strengthen the capacity of the agencies on informal sector enrollment, marketing, and communication strategies.
  • Strengthen the capacity of the agencies in client's registration, premium collection including seasonal collection, product layered contribution, and installment payment, etc.
N/B: Period of Performance of Grant Under Contract: Approximately March 1, 2022 - September 30, 2022(must be fully completed no later than September 30, 2022)
